EDITORS COMMENTS
This image showcases the Knox Pay-as-you-enter bus, a remarkable innovation in public transportation during the early 1910s. The bus, manufactured by the Knox Automobile Company in Springfield, Massachusetts, USA, boasts an impressive 28-passenger capacity. The Knox Pay-as-you-enter bus, a testament to the ingenuity of the automobile engineering during this era, was a significant departure from the conventional horse-drawn buses and early motorized models. With its sleek design and modern appearance, it embodied the spirit of progress and technological advancement that characterized the early 20th century. The bus in this photograph is featured in the Cyclopedia of Automobile Engineering, Volume 10, Plate 10, from the esteemed Mary Evans Picture Library. The Cyclopedia, a comprehensive reference work on automobile engineering, showcases the Knox Pay-as-you-enter bus as an example of the latest developments in bus design and technology. The Knox Automobile Company, established in Watertown, Massachusetts, in 1892, was known for its high-quality automobiles and buses. The company's commitment to innovation and excellence is evident in the design and construction of this bus, which allowed passengers to pay their fares as they entered, making the bus ride more convenient and efficient for all.
